Steem (STEEM) Trading Down 2.7% Over Last Week

Steem (STEEM) traded 0.9% lower against the dollar during the 24-hour period ending at 20:00 PM ET on July 2nd. Steem has a market cap of $90.10 million and $1.63 million worth of Steem was traded on exchanges in the last day. During the last seven days, Steem has traded 2.7% lower against the dollar. One Steem coin can now be bought for $0.19 or 0.00000312 BTC on popular exchanges.

According to CryptoCompare, “Steem (STEEM) is a blockchain-based social media platform that rewards content creators with STEEM tokens. Created by Ned Scott and Dan Larimer, it promotes decentralized content creation and curation, providing an alternative to traditional social media.”
